Usher

Usher is not only an R&B music icon, he is a singer, dancer, actor, producer, dynamic performer, coach on ‘The Voice’ and mentor to Justin Bieber. Born Usher Terry Raymond IV in 1978, the Texas native spent much of his youth in Tennessee. He joined a boy band at age 11, but started his professional career in earnest at 13 after being discovered via TV talent show ‘Star Search.’ His self-titled debut album dropped before he even graduated high school. Second album ‘My Way’ put him on the pop-music map and featured his first No. 1 hit, ‘Nice & Slow.’ But it was 2004’s ‘Confessions’ that made him a superstar, with four consecutive Billboard Hot 100 chart-toppers ('Yeah!,' 'Burn,' 'Confessions Part II' and 'My Boo').

Selected discography: ‘My Way’ (1997), ‘Confessions’ (2004), ‘Raymond v. Raymond’ (2010)
